Silica fume (microsilica, CAS 69012-64-2) is an ultra-fine powder of amorphous SiO₂ produced as a by-product of electric arc furnace operations during the production of silicon metal or ferrosilicon alloys. Particles have a diameter of approximately 0.15 µm — about 100 times smaller than Portland cement — and a BET specific surface area of 15,000–30,000 m²/kg.

Mechanisms of action:
1. Fill effect — ultra-fine particles fill the voids between cement grains, densifying the microstructure of the concrete matrix.
2. Pozzolanic effect — SiO₂ reacts with Ca(OH)₂ released during cement hydration, forming additional C-S-H gel that increases strength and durability.
Applications:
• High-performance concrete (HPC/UHPC): bridges, tunnels, deep foundations, industrial slabs
• Fiber-cement composites and wood-wool cement boards
• Dry-mix systems (drywall/AAC): improved adhesion and moisture resistance
• Refractory materials: castables and refractory concrete for steel and cement kilns
• Oil and gas well cementing (API standards)
• Paints and sealants: micro-filler improving rheology
